about summary refs log tree commit diff
path: root/users/tazjin/emacs/config/init.el
diff options
context:
space:
mode:
authorVincent Ambo <tazjin@tvl.su>2023-11-30T18·20+0300
committerclbot <clbot@tvl.fyi>2023-12-01T16·22+0000
commit3f60140402cc8ede665bea5f0f733c54e44a9d47 (patch)
tree6ba95255a3f9d47e2e9a3a6fa67a734f8018ad9a /users/tazjin/emacs/config/init.el
parentdfd93efee0c918e277765c331bd4e52fef58acf6 (diff)
chore(tazjin/emacs): remove company-mode r/7101
I have a suspicion that some strange behaviour I occasionally get is
related to company mode.

Change-Id: I26f25c31967ae092d15248a806acdf4f28cb4c10
Reviewed-on: https://cl.tvl.fyi/c/depot/+/10176
Reviewed-by: tazjin <tazjin@tvl.su>
Autosubmit: tazjin <tazjin@tvl.su>
Tested-by: BuildkiteCI
Diffstat (limited to 'users/tazjin/emacs/config/init.el')
-rw-r--r--users/tazjin/emacs/config/init.el14
1 files changed, 3 insertions, 11 deletions
diff --git a/users/tazjin/emacs/config/init.el b/users/tazjin/emacs/config/init.el
index 7233ec9c6d6b..9d78af8964a4 100644
--- a/users/tazjin/emacs/config/init.el
+++ b/users/tazjin/emacs/config/init.el
@@ -29,10 +29,6 @@
 
 (use-package browse-kill-ring)
 
-(use-package company
-  :hook ((prog-mode . company-mode))
-  :config (setq company-tooltip-align-annotations t))
-
 (use-package consult
   :bind
   ("C-c r g" . consult-ripgrep)
@@ -141,9 +137,7 @@
 
 (use-package ielm
   :hook ((inferior-emacs-lisp-mode . (lambda ()
-                                       (paredit-mode)
-                                       (rainbow-delimiters-mode-enable)
-                                       (company-mode)))))
+                                       (rainbow-delimiters-mode-enable)))))
 
 (use-package jq-mode
   :config (add-to-list 'auto-mode-alist '("\\.jq\\'" . jq-mode)))
@@ -170,8 +164,7 @@
 (use-package sly
   :hook ((sly-mrepl-mode . (lambda ()
                              (paredit-mode)
-                             (rainbow-delimiters-mode-enable)
-                             (company-mode))))
+                             (rainbow-delimiters-mode-enable))))
   :config
   (setq common-lisp-hyperspec-root "file:///home/tazjin/docs/lisp/"))
 
@@ -183,8 +176,7 @@
   :config (telega-mode-line-mode 1)
   :custom
   (telega-emoji-use-images nil)
-  (telega-completing-read-function #'completing-read)
-  :hook (telega-chat-mode . company-mode))
+  (telega-completing-read-function #'completing-read))
 
 (use-package terraform-mode)
 (use-package toml-ts-mode)